    In my search to bring the classics like the original doom, and Duke Nukem3d to my computer again. I ran across one problem, XP compatibility. I downloaded the zip and tried to install...and runtime error in my DOS window. I don't think it likes XP . Changing the compatibilty didn't help either.

    Anyone know of anyway to get these kinds of games working on XP?

    Old games, wich are based on DOS will usually not run in XP, I have a very large collection of old games (like Indiana Jones: The secret of atlantis...i think), and they simply refuse to run under XP, largley due to the fact that XP dosen't have a DOS mode. And Duke Nukem3d is DOS based. So U'll have to either install windows 95 or 98 on another partition, or get a old comp and run the games there.

    It's very easy to run DOS games under XP. Some even run better than under 98SE.

    Compatibility mode helps somewhat. If you're needing sound, get VDMSound. The one game I have that it didn't work with was Gabriel Knight I.
